One thing you could try is putting some gaffer tape on the beater head, when doing this you have to pinch loops into it (about 1/4 of a cm tall). It doesn't need to be overly long. I do this for almost all of my drums as it dampens down the resonance. I use a steel snare and the ring on that is unbareable without tape on it.
